PATNA, Nov 6: A voter turnout of 64.46 per cent was recorded provisionally at the close of polling in 121 seats in the first phase of assembly elections in Bihar on Thursday, Chief Electoral Officer (CEO) Vinod Singh Gunjiyal said. A total of 3.75 crore voters were eligible to exercise their franchise in this phase, to decide the electoral fate of 1,314 candidates, he said. Patna, Nov 6 (PTI) Amid stray incidents of violence, including an attack on Deputy Chief Minister Vijay Kumar Sinhas vehicle, 60.18 per cent of 3.75 crore voters exercised their franchise till 5 pm on Thursday across 121 constituencies in the first phase of Bihar assembly elections. Begusarai district recorded the highest polling percentage so far at 67.32, followed by Samastipur (66.65) and Madhepura (65.74). NEW DELHI, Nov 6: The Election Commission on Thursday announced that mock polls at all polling stations across the 121 constituencies in Bihar that are part of the first phase of the elections have concluded. During the mock poll, representatives of the candidates were present, and the process included verifying the votes cast on the Electronic Voting Machines (EVMs) against the Voter Verified Paper Audit Trail (VVPAT) slips, the commission added. NIOS exams Bihar: The National Institute of Open Schooling (NIOS) has postponed exams in Bihar due to the assembly elections. Exams initially scheduled for November 6, 10, and 11 at Bihar centres are affected, including subjects such as Physics, History, Biology, Mathematics, and Painting. Secondary and higher secondary students in the state should await new dates, while exams at other centres continue as planned. CHENNAI: Responding to Congress leader Rahul Gandhis allegations of large-scale voter fraud in the 2024 Haryana assembly elections, the Election Commission of India (ECI) countered by saying the party failed to file any objections or appeals during the electoral roll revision. Responding to Gandhis claim of an H-Bomb scam in the polls, EC officials said the Congress did not raise a single objection through its Booth Level Agents (BLAs) during the roll revision process.
